
A former Wisconsin Badgers football star has entered a not guilty plea in Rock County Circuit Court to charges of first-degree intentional homicide.
Marcus Randle El was first charged last year and made a virtual court appearance Monday (February 22nd) for two separate hearings.
Randle El is accused of killing Seairaha Winchester and Brittany McAdory in Janesville on February 10th, 2020. The women were discovered suffering from gunshot wounds and died when doctors weren’t able to save their lives.
Investigators say one of the two victims feared for her life because she owed Randle El money.
He turned himself in to Chicago police five days after the double-killing.
